Thanks Canyon and to everyone who has taken a look at our Indiana Jones and the Crystal Cave fan film. We shot some great new footage this past week at Callaway Gardens in Pine Mountain, Georgia. We have tons of cool footage from some great locations like The Porcupine Mountains in the Upper Peninsula Michigan to The Ice Palace at the St. Paul Winter Carnival and we are planning to shoot some more in central Florida next month when we visit Thomas’ Grandparents. (We are also looking forward to visiting the IJ epic stunt show at Disney’s MGM Studios). I am looking at the best way to tie these elements together into a good story. Right now the parts that are online for viewing were all shot in our back yard here in Minnesota. You might notice some of the same things in the backgrounds from part one and part two even though part one takes place in the Snow covered Himalayas and Part two takes place in South America. It really is all in the same small area of our back yard in the suburbs. Anyway this is a really fun project for our whole family. Keep checking back to our web site for updates. We plan to introduce some new characters soon including my 5 year old daughter who did some great speaking parts on our last vacation. Hello fellow Indy Fans! Well it’s been a long time coming but we have started working on our new version of Indiana Jones and the Crystal Cave. This Fan film is all kids. We are currently gearing up for school to let out for the summer and then principle photography will be underway. Since our last fan film (shot in our back yard in Minnesota) we have moved to Orlando Florida. My son (Who plays Indy) is two years older and we have a very diverse cast of kids. This version promises to be superior to our other one. I am dedicating a whole section of my website to share our movie and its production as it progresses. Please check it out and drop us an email.
